Social Media Feud Erupts: Ari Lennox Blasts Joe Budden for Podcast Comments

The simmering tension between R&B singer Ari Lennox and media personality Joe Budden boiled into a fiery social media spat in early 2024. The cause? Budden made a seemingly harmless comment on his podcast, “The Joe Budden Podcast,” while discussing J. Cole’s recent apology to Kendrick Lamar.
During the episode, Budden critiqued J. Cole’s sincerity in the apology, claiming it lacked conviction. He then used Ari Lennox’s name in an unrelated discussion about the nature of rap beef. Budden categorized Lennox and rapper Scottie as artists who cultivate a more “earthy college campus” vibe, contrasting it with J. Cole’s focus on lyrical prowess.
Lennox, clearly not amused by being brought into the conversation, took to Instagram to unleash her frustration. She bombarded her followers with a clip of rapper Consequence punching Budden during a reunion taping of “Love and Hip Hop: New York” – a clear message that she wouldn’t tolerate disrespect. The accompanying caption was a rebuke of Budden, calling him out for alleged animal abuse, misogyny, and online harassment.
This wasn’t the first time these two had crossed paths. Earlier that year, Budden criticized Lennox for sharing her struggles as the opening act for Rod Wave’s tour. Lennox, frustrated by the audience’s negative reception, had vented on social media. Budden, on his podcast, advised her to handle such issues internally with her team instead of airing dirty laundry online.
Lennox’s response to Budden’s latest comments was swift and brutal. She accused him of obsession, dredged up Drake’s past diss of Budden, and even threatened legal action. The insult-laden rant painted Budden as a bitter failure with questionable hygiene.
Budden eventually attempted a form of apology on a subsequent podcast episode. However, it fell flat for many. He acknowledged the importance of supporting women in the industry but then proceeded to accuse Lennox of trying to “demean and defame” him and called her a derogatory term. It was a confusing and contradictory attempt at reconciliation.
